To: Calvin Locke

Hay. We have about 6-7 acres in mostly brome. A neighbor bales it a couple of times each year and we keep a bale or two when needed. We don’t have animals to feed over the winter nor do we have the equipment to take care of it ourselves. It’s a fair swap. We still have several square bales leftover from a previous year that we use around the garden. It comes in quite handy! I use it in the nesting boxes and give the hens a chunk of it every once in awhile. They love scratching through it.
